R7 EXPERT / PRO SERVICE GUIDE
AIR SPRING SERVICE

Using Manitou 24mm Flat Ground
Socket, rotate air spring top cap
counter-clockwise and remove
when threads completely disengage
from the stanchion.
Invert the fork. Using a 22mm
wrench, rotate the air spring
end cap counter-clockwise until
threads completely disengage from
stanchion.
Remove air spring assembly. Clean
assembly with isopropyl alcohol
and a lint-free towel. Inspect air
spring shaft, bumpers, and air
piston seal for wear/damage and
replace if necessary.
Do not begin disassembly until
completely depressurizing air
spring.
CAUTION
Make sure to apply top down
force on tool to prevent slipping
NOTICE
